Standby or Hibernation Functions
To enter standby or hibernation
1 Close the display, or slide the power switch (A) until a beep
*1
sounds.
Standby: The power indicator (A) blinks green.
Hibernation: The power indicator (A) goes off.
z You can alternatively use the Windows menu to enter standby or hibernation. To enter
standby, click [start] - [Turn Off Computer] - [Stand By]. To enter hibernation, click [start] -
[Turn Off Computer], then press and hold
Shift
and click [Hibernate].
CAUTION
While the computer is entering standby or hibernation
z Do not:
Touch the keyboard, Touch Pad, touchscreen (only for CF-T8 Series), or power switch.
Use an external mouse or other peripheral devices.
Connect or disconnect the AC adaptor.
<Only for CF-F8/CF-W8 Series>
Operate the drive power/open switch.
Operate the wireless switch.
Close or open the display.
Insert and remove the SD/SDHC Memory Card.
Wait until the power indicator blinks green (standby) or goes off (hibernation).
z It may take one or two minutes to enter standby or hibernation.
z At the beep
*1
, immediately release the power switch. After releasing the switch, do not operate it until the power indi-
cator blinks or goes off. If you slide and hold the power switch for longer than four seconds, the computer will forcibly
shut down and unsaved data will be lost even if you have set [Shut down] in [When I press the power button on my
computer:] (Î page 38 “Setting Standby or Hibernation”).
In standby or hibernation
z Do not attach or remove a peripheral device. Doing so may cause malfunction.
z Power is consumed in standby. Power consumption may increase when a PC Card is inserted. When power is
exhausted, the data retained in memory will be lost. Connect the AC adaptor when using the standby function.
*1
[If the speakers are muted, beeps do not sound.
